50 inches is equal to 1270 millimeters.

This conversion is done by multiplying the number of inches by 25.4, since one inch equals exactly 25.4 millimeters. So, 50 multiplied by 25.4 results in 1270 millimeters, showing how we convert length from imperial to metric units.

Conversion Formula

The formula to convert inches (in) to millimeters (mm) is:

millimeters = inches × 25.4

This works because 1 inch is defined as exactly 25.4 millimeters by international agreement. So, to find how many millimeters any given inches equals, you multiply that number of inches by 25.4.

For example, converting 50 inches:

  • Start with 50 inches.
  • Multiply 50 by 25.4.
  • 50 × 25.4 = 1270 mm.

This simple multiplication gives you the conversion result from inches to millimeters.

Conversion Definitions

in (inch): Inch is a unit of length in the imperial and US customary measurement systems. One inch equals exactly 2.54 centimeters or 25.4 millimeters. It is commonly used in the United States, Canada, and the UK for measuring small distances or dimensions.

mm (millimeter): Millimeter is a metric unit of length, equal to one thousandth of a meter. It is used worldwide for precise measurements, especially in engineering, manufacturing, and construction. One millimeter equals 0.03937 inches.

Conversion FAQs

Why is the conversion factor between inches and millimeters 25.4?

The inch was internationally standardized as exactly 25.4 millimeters by agreement among countries. This exact number replaces older definitions based on physical standards. This makes calculations consistent and precise for converting between imperial and metric units.

Is it accurate to multiply inches by 25.4 every time I convert to millimeters?

Yes, multiplying by 25.4 is the precise and accepted method to convert inches to millimeters. Since 1 inch equals 25.4 mm exactly, no approximations are needed, so the method is accurate for all practical purposes.

Can I convert fractional inches to millimeters using the same formula?

Absolutely, fractions or decimals of inches can be converted by multiplying their decimal value by 25.4. For example, 1.5 inches equals 1.5 × 25.4 = 38.1 mm. The formula applies to any numeric value in inches.

Does temperature or pressure affect the inch to millimeter conversion?

No, the conversion between inches and millimeters is a fixed mathematical relationship and does not depend on physical conditions like temperature or pressure. Length measurements may vary physically due to expansion, but the conversion factor stays constant.
